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Using Group Notifications as a Summary of Child Devices #4829

Closed
2 tasks done
alkcbs opened this issue Jun 6, 2024 · 2 comments
Closed
2 tasks done

Using Group Notifications as a Summary of Child Devices #4829

alkcbs opened this issue Jun 6, 2024 · 2 comments
Labels
area:notifications Everything related to notifications help question Further information is requested type:enhance-existing feature wants to enhance existing monitor

Comments

@alkcbs
Copy link

alkcbs commented Jun 6, 2024

⚠️ Please verify that this question has NOT been raised before.

  • I checked and didn't find similar issue

🛡️ Security Policy

📝 Describe your problem

New Uptime Kuma user here (a few weeks in). I am hoping to utilize groups to monitor various 'clusters' of equipment. For example, I am at the HQ location for my company, and we have branches 1, 2, and 3 as well. Within the HQ, we have multiple buildings. Therefore, in addition to monitoring some individual items, I'd also like to monitor "is branch 1 down" or "is the annex down" in addition to "is just the server at branch 1 down, but everything else is up."

I have found that when using group notifications, if something in that group is down, the email body simply states "[Group name] [Down] Child inaccessible." This unfortunately is not helpful, as I need to know which device(s) within the group are down. The only way I can find to do that is to alert on each device individually, which then makes the group notification redundant (if 1/5 devices is down, we get 2 notifications. If 5/5 devices are down, we get 6 notifications; one for each device and one for the group).

Is it possible to have the group alert email body to state something along the lines of:

"[Group name] [Down] 2/5 Children inaccessible.

DOWN: [device that is down]
DOWN: [device 2 that is down]
UP: [device 3]
UP: [device 4]
UP: [device 5]"

This would make it possible to configure alerts ONLY at the group level, so if an entire branch goes down, we get one summary email, instead of one notification per device.

Thank you!

📝 Error Message(s) or Log

No response

🐻 Uptime-Kuma Version

1.23.13

💻 Operating System and Arch

Windows 11 Pro x64

🌐 Browser

Microsoft Edge Version 125.0.2535.85 (Official build) (64-bit)

🖥️ Deployment Environment

  • Runtime: nodejs 22.2.0
  • Database: whatever comes with a non-Docker Windows install by default
  • Filesystem used to store the database on: Windows NTFS, SSD
  • number of monitors: 58
@alkcbs alkcbs added the help label Jun 6, 2024
@CommanderStorm
Copy link
Collaborator

Currently, I don't have a good answer to this. You could split them up into two channels depending on your usage, but this is likely not a good workflow.

This issue is already discussed in these issues.

In some of these consensus has been reached, in some not ^^

@CommanderStorm CommanderStorm added area:notifications Everything related to notifications question Further information is requested type:enhance-existing feature wants to enhance existing monitor labels Jun 6, 2024
@CommanderStorm
Copy link
Collaborator

Think the comment above resolves your question Is it possible to have the group alert email body to state something along the lines of. Forgot to close as resolved

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
area:notifications Everything related to notifications help question Further information is requested type:enhance-existing feature wants to enhance existing monitor
Projects
None yet
Development

No branches or pull requests

2 participants